Southpoint Qualified Fund and Southpoint Qualified Offshore Fund returned 2.5% net for the first quarter, compared to the S&P 500’s 6.2% return and the Russell 2000’s 12.7% gain. During the first quarter, Southpoint’s funds averaged 133% long and 70% short.

The fund’s long positions added 13% gross to the quarterly return, while its short positions subtracted 8.7% gross. Southpoint’s average long increased in value by 9.8%, while its average short increased in value by 13% during the first quarter. The fund employs a long/ short equity strategy, and its principals previously worked at David Einhorn’s Greenlight Capital.
